WebApr 13, 2024 · If you’re already chafed, try these self-care measures to treat it: Clean the area. Before treating chafed skin, make sure to clean the area thoroughly with mild soap and water. Gently pat the area dry with a clean towel. Use a moisturizer. With clean hands, apply petroleum jelly or other moisturizers to protect the skin from further chafing. WebJul 27, 2024 · Ditch the sweaty clothes post-workout. "Wet skin can make chafing worse because moisture can weaken the skin barrier function, leaving the skin more vulnerable", she said. "Apply powders to absorb moisture and don't stay in wet or sweaty clothing". Lubricate. "Apply [petroleum jelly] or other anti-chafing products, like a wax glide, to hot ... WebDec 28, 2024 · Get rid of sweat around the chafed skin by washing the affected area with mild soaps or cleansers. Pat the skin dry using a clean towel. You can also use antiseptic solutions or salt water to wash the skin, especially in the case of wounds. WebJan 20, 2024 · The first home remedy for relieving groin chafing is using cool compresses. Take a cold, damp cloth or towel and gently press onto the affected skin for several minutes at a time, or until you feel relief from any itching or pain you experience due to the chafing. You can do this multiple times throughout the day.
